libarchive 3.8.1 New features: #2088 7-zip reader: improve self-extracting archive detection #2137 zip writer: added XZ, LZMA, ZSTD and BZIP2 support #2403 zip writer: added LZMA + RISCV BCJ filter #2601 bsdtar: support --mtime and --clamp-mtime #2602 libarchive: mbedtls 3.x compatibility Security fixes: #2422 tar reader: Handle truncation in the middle of a GNU long linkname (CVE-2024-57970) #2532 tar reader: fix unchecked return value in list_item_verbose() (CVE-2025-25724) #2532 unzip: fix null pointer dereference (CVE-2025-1632) #2568 warc: prevent signed integer overflow (CVE-2025-5916) #2584 rar: do not skip past EOF while reading (CVE-2025-5918) #2588 tar: fix overflow in build_ustar_entry (CVE-2025-5917) #2598 rar: fix double free with over 4 billion nodes (CVE-2025-5914) #2599 rar: fix heap-buffer-overflow (CVE-2025-5915) Important bugfixes: #2399 7-zip reader: add SPARC filter support for non-LZMA compressors #2405 tar reader: ignore ustar size when pax size is present #2435 tar writer: fix bug when -s/a/b/ used more than once with b flag #2459 7-zip reader: add POWERPC filter support for non-LZMA compressors #2519 libarchive: handle ARCHIVE_FILTER_LZOP in archive_read_append_filter #2539 libarchive: add missing seeker function to archive_read_open_FILE() #2544 gzip: allow setting the original filename for gzip compressed files #2564 libarchive: improve lseek handling #2582 rar: support large headers on 32 bit systems #2587 bsdtar: don't hardlink negative inode files together #2596 rar: support large headers on 32 bit systems #2606 libarchive: support @-prefixed Unix epoch timestamps as date strings #2634 tar: Support negative time values with pax #2637 tar: Keep block alignment after pax error #2642 libarchive: fix FILE_skip regression #2643 tar: Handle extra bytes after sparse entries #2649 compress: Prevent call stack overflow #2651 iso9660: always check archive_string_ensure return value CVE: CVE-2024-57970, CVE-2025-1632, CVE-2025-25724, CVE-2025-5914, CVE-2025-5915, CVE-2025-5916, CVE-2025-5917, CVE-2025-5918 PR: 286944 (exp-run, main, libarchive 3.8.0) Approved by: so Security: FreeBSD-SA-25:07.libarchive (cherry picked from commit 2e113ef82465598b8c26e0ca415fbe90677fbd47) (cherry picked from commit 6dad4525a2910496ecf3c41de659aac906f6c1f4)
